| 1. An optical device for guiding illumination comprising:
a body with a surface having a plurality of acutely angled ramp structures; and
each of said ramp structures having a front exit face for distributing said light, in which light when inputted at one end
of said device is substantially totally internally reflected within said body until substantially distributed from the front
exit face of each of said ramp structures, wherein said body has a first end representing said one end for inputting light,
and a second end, and said ramp structures extend along a dimension between said first end and said second end representing
the axis of the device, in which said ramp structures each have a ramp surface at an acute angle with respect to said axis,
and the front exit face of each of said ramp structures represents a surface at an acute angle with respect to the normal
of said axis, and wherein:
ΘR represents the angle of the ramp surface with respect to said axis;
ΘEF represents the angle of said front exit face of each of said structures with respect to the normal of said axis;
said body is of material having a refractive index (NA);
Rn is a ratio of the refractive index of the material of said body to a refractive index of the medium surrounding said body;
and
said angles ΘR and ΘEF are selected in accordance with at least equations:
